Transaction 7fd55963a918b0818e3667f707f050b9c242deb156ffccc2ed7e79a02145cf4e
1 Input
1 Output
-
7fd55963a918b0818e3667f707f050b9c242deb156ffccc2ed7e79a02145cf4e:0
- value
- 553355
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 001ab32699ac4461041fccd6ea6a5381f5489517 OP_EQUAL
- address
- 31hZugL8p2U4oLbqpbx2mxCtsHCwQkZfeT